Sun Sept 15
Both the All Weather(ALB) and Inshore(ILB) Lifeboats were launched
at 1209 to a report of a boat on fire in Balls Lake. The ILB was
first on scene where they found a cabin cruiser with an over-heated
engine at Hutchins Buoy. The boat's automatic extinguisher had operated
but the engine was still smoking. The ILB removed 3 people from
the boat and a harbour launch removed another 2 and a dog! The ILB
crew also removed a gas cylinder before retiring to a safe distance
as the cabin cruiser had 80 litres of fuel onboard. The ILB landed
the people ashore at Rockley. The ALB assessed it as safe to tow
the cabin cruiser and towed it to Royal Marines Poole, where the
local Fire Brigade inspected the boat to ensure that the fire would
not re-ignite. The ALB then towed the boat to its mooring at Rockley.The
ILB and ALB were away from Station for just over an hour and a half.
